jQuery 是一个广泛使用的 JavaScript 库,它极大地简化了 HTML 文档的遍历、事件处理、动画和 Ajax 交互。在开发过程中,调试是不可或缺的一环。本文将详细介绍如何使用 jQuery 进行有效的调试,帮助开发者轻松解决编码难题。
一、jQuery 调试基础
1.1 了解 jQuery 的调试模式
jQuery 提供了多种调试模式,可以帮助开发者更好地理解和追踪代码执行过程。以下是一些常用的调试模式:
- console.log():在控制台输出信息,方便查看变量的值或函数的执行过程。
- alert():弹出一个警告框,用于中断代码执行,查看当前的状态。
- console.error():在控制台输出错误信息,方便定位问题。
- console.warn():在控制台输出警告信息,提醒开发者注意潜在的问题。
1.2 使用开发者工具
现代浏览器都内置了强大的开发者工具,可以帮助开发者进行调试。以下是一些常用的开发者工具功能:
- 元素检查:查看和修改 HTML 元素的属性和样式。
- 网络监控:查看和调试网络请求。
- 源代码:查看和调试 JavaScript 代码。
- 控制台:执行 JavaScript 代码,查看变量值,调试函数执行过程。
二、jQuery 调试技巧
2.1 选择器调试
选择器是 jQuery 中最常用的功能之一,但有时也会出现选择器错误。以下是一些调试选择器的技巧:
- 缩小选择器范围:从更具体的选择器开始,逐步缩小范围,直到找到正确的选择器。
- 使用开发者工具:查看元素的 HTML 结构,确认选择器的正确性。
- 使用 console.log() 输出选择结果:在控制台输出选择结果,查看是否选择了正确的元素。
2.2 事件绑定调试
事件绑定是 jQuery 中的另一个重要功能,以下是一些调试事件绑定的技巧:
- 检查事件类型:确保事件类型正确,例如 “click”、”mouseover” 等。
- 检查事件委托:如果使用事件委托,确保委托元素和目标元素正确。
- 使用开发者工具:查看事件监听器列表,确认事件绑定正确。
2.3 动画调试
jQuery 提供了丰富的动画功能,以下是一些调试动画的技巧:
- 检查动画参数:确保动画参数正确,例如持续时间、缓动函数等。
- 使用开发者工具:查看动画执行过程,确认动画效果。
- 使用 console.log() 输出动画状态:在动画执行过程中,输出动画状态,查看动画是否按预期执行。
三、总结
jQuery 是一个功能强大的 JavaScript 库,掌握 jQuery 调试技巧对于开发者来说至关重要。通过本文的介绍,相信你已经对 jQuery 调试有了更深入的了解。在实际开发过程中,不断实践和总结,相信你将能够更加熟练地使用 jQuery,解决各种编码难题。
